On January 5th, Quentin Tarantino added his hand and footprints to concrete outside Hollywood’s famed TCL Chinese Theatre. 
He also left a phrase he has been known to use with some regularity – ‘F*** You.’ 
The message was cut into the soles of his shoes, which, according to TMZ, are replicas of the ones Uma Thurman wore in Kill Bill: Volume 1. 
At this time, it is unknown if the theater has plans to somehow conceal or otherwise obliterate the expletive.
